Plan for the Unexpected

It's crucial to anticipate unexpected challenges and setbacks during your home renovation, so you can be prepared for any situation that may arise. Here are three things to keep in mind when planning for the unexpected:
  1. Plan for budget contingencies: Even with the most detailed plan and cost estimate, unforeseen expenses can still pop up during a home renovation project. To avoid going over budget, it's important to set aside an emergency fund or contingency budget of at least 10-20% of your total project cost.
  2. Have an emergency plan in place: In case something goes wrong during the renovation process, such as damage to your property or injuries on site, having a well-planned emergency response strategy can help prevent further harm or delays. Make sure everyone involved in the project knows what steps to take in case of an emergency.
  3. Expect delays and setbacks: Renovation projects rarely go exactly according to plan. Be prepared for possible delays caused by weather conditions, material shortages, permit issues, or other unforeseeable situations that might arise.

Install Energy-Efficient Windows

Transform your home with energy-efficient windows that not only save you money on utility bills but also enhance the overall look and feel of your living space. Here are three reasons why installing energy-efficient windows is a smart move:
  1. Types of energy efficient windows: There are several types of energy-efficient windows, including double-pane, triple-pane, low-e coatings, and gas-filled panes. Each type offers unique benefits in terms of insulation and UV protection.
  2. Benefits of installing energy efficient windows: Energy-efficient windows can reduce your heating and cooling costs by up to 25%, improve indoor comfort levels, block harmful UV rays that can fade furniture and carpets, and reduce outside noise.
  3. Increase home value: Installing energy-efficient features like windows can increase the value of your home when it comes time to sell it. Potential buyers will appreciate the added benefits of these upgrades.

Safety and Regulations

Ensuring safety compliance is crucial for any construction project to avoid potential hazards and legal issues. In the UK, there are regulatory requirements that must be met regarding health and safety in construction sites. These regulations include the Construction (Design and Management) Regulations 2015, which require a detailed risk assessment to be conducted before commencing work on a site. This assessment should identify potential hazards and set out measures to mitigate them. It is also important to ensure that all workers on the site have received adequate training and have access to personal protective equipment (PPE). Regular safety audits should be carried out throughout the course of the project to ensure that all necessary precautions are being taken. By prioritizing safety compliance, you can prevent accidents from occurring, protect your workers, and avoid costly legal battles. Regulations and Standards for Sustainable Construction in the UK

Regulatory compliance and certification programs are at the forefront of sustainable construction in the UK. As a builder or developer, it is important to be aware of these regulations and standards to ensure you are meeting requirements and staying up-to-date with industry trends. Here are four key things to know:
  1. BREEAM (Building Research Establishment Environmental Assessment Method) is one of the most commonly used certification programs in the UK, which assesses buildings based on categories such as energy efficiency, indoor air quality, and materials used.
  2. The Code for Sustainable Homes is another certification program that focuses on residential properties, with levels ranging from 1-6 based on sustainability criteria.
  3. The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rates a building's energy efficiency from A-G, with anything below an E considered unacceptable.
  4. Building Regulations set out minimum standards for construction projects in areas such as insulation, ventilation, and heating systems.
Knowing these regulations and standards can help you make informed decisions about your construction projects while also contributing to a more environmentally conscious future in the UK.
